CASARI, Leandro Martín; ANGLADA, Johana  y  DAHER, Celeste. Coping strategies and exam anxiety in college students. Rev. psicol. (Lima) [online]. 2014, vol.32, n.2, pp. 243-269. ISSN 0254-9247.

This paper analyzed the coping strategies and exam anxiety in 140 Psychology majors at the University of the Aconcagua, in the state of Mendoza. It also evaluated the differences and the relationship between these two variables according to gender, completed courses and academic year. Results showed that the coping strategies included the Search for Alternative Bonuses and Emotional Discharge; students also reported a low level of anxiety. Significant associations were found between these two variables, as well in relation to gender and the academic year. No significant results were found in the relationship with completed courses.
